On Thu, 2008-10-16 at 22:50 +0100, Ian Campbell wrote:
> On Thu, 2008-10-16 at 22:47 +0200, Bastian Blank wrote:
> > On Thu, Oct 16, 2008 at 09:38:58PM +0100, Ian Campbell wrote:
> > > On Thu, 2008-10-16 at 20:52 +0200, Bastian Blank wrote:
> > > > I'm not able to get a console using xencons=off
> > > > console=hvc0. I would have been surprised anyway as the hvc_xen driver
> > > > is disabled by the patch.
> > > I'd guess it won't be as simple as removing this bit of Kconfig.
> >
> > Nope. I already tried and only partially succeeded. To be exact:
> > console via xenconsoled works, via hypervisor not.
>
> How about something like this would work as a skanky hack to unify the
> names at least. (it doesn't actually work for some reason, I suspect
> it's trivial but it's late so I'll look into it over the weekend)
It did work, I just needed to update my initrd (I thought I'd get away
with the 2.6.26-1-xen-amd64 since localversion was the same but didn't
for some reason).

> --- drivers/xen/console/console.c.orig 2008-10-16 19:33:22.000000000 +0100
> +++ drivers/xen/console/console.c 2008-10-16 22:35:57.000000000 +0100
> @@ -66,20 +66,25 @@
> * 'xencons=tty' [XC_TTY]: Console attached to '/dev/tty[0-9]+'.
> * 'xencons=ttyS' [XC_SERIAL]: Console attached to '/dev/ttyS[0-9]+'.
> * 'xencons=xvc' [XC_XVC]: Console attached to '/dev/xvc0'.
> - * default: XC_XVC
> + * 'xencons=hvc' [XC_HVC]: Console attached to '/dev/hvc0'.
> + * default: XC_HVC
> *
> * NB. In mode XC_TTY, we create dummy consoles for tty2-63. This suppresses
> * warnings from standard distro startup scripts.
> */
> static enum {
> - XC_OFF, XC_TTY, XC_SERIAL, XC_XVC
> -} xc_mode = XC_XVC;
> + XC_OFF, XC_TTY, XC_SERIAL, XC_XVC, XC_HVC
> +} xc_mode = XC_HVC;
> static int xc_num = -1;
>
> /* /dev/xvc0 device number allocated by lanana.org. */
> #define XEN_XVC_MAJOR 204
> #define XEN_XVC_MINOR 191
>
> +/* /dev/hvc0 device number */
> +#define XEN_HVC_MAJOR 229
> +#define XEN_HVC_MINOR 0
> +
> static int __init xencons_setup(char *str)
> {
> char *q;
> @@ -97,6 +102,9 @@
> } else if (!strncmp(str, "xvc", 3)) {
> xc_mode = XC_XVC;
> str += 3;
> + } else if (!strncmp(str, "hvc", 3)) {
> + xc_mode = XC_HVC;
> + str += 3;
> } else if (!strncmp(str, "off", 3)) {
> xc_mode = XC_OFF;
> str += 3;
> @@ -205,6 +213,12 @@
> xc_num = 0;
> break;
>
> + case XC_HVC:
> + strcpy(kcons_info.name, "hvc");
> + if (xc_num == -1)
> + xc_num = 0;
> + break;
> +
> case XC_SERIAL:
> strcpy(kcons_info.name, "ttyS");
> if (xc_num == -1)
> @@ -681,6 +695,12 @@
> DRV(xencons_driver)->minor_start = XEN_XVC_MINOR;
> DRV(xencons_driver)->name_base = xc_num;
> break;
> + case XC_HVC:
> + DRV(xencons_driver)->name = "hvc";
> + DRV(xencons_driver)->major = XEN_HVC_MAJOR;
> + DRV(xencons_driver)->minor_start = XEN_HVC_MINOR;
> + DRV(xencons_driver)->name_base = xc_num;
> + break;
> case XC_SERIAL:
> DRV(xencons_driver)->name = "ttyS";
> DRV(xencons_driver)->minor_start = 64 + xc_num;
